Product Description
The Transition CFBRM1329-102 represents a sophisticated approach to media conversion, focusing on manageability and operational efficiency. As a 'Point System,' it suggests a modular or chassis-based architecture where multiple media converter modules can be housed and managed centrally. This design is ideal for environments requiring high port density and centralized control over network connectivity. The inclusion of OAM (Operations, Administration, and Maintenance) capabilities signifies that the device supports advanced network management features. This allows for remote monitoring of link status, performance diagnostics, fault detection, and configuration management without requiring physical access to each individual converter. The IP-based management further enhances this by enabling control and monitoring over standard IP networks, often through web interfaces, SNMP, or command-line interfaces (CLI). This system is tailored for applications where network uptime, performance, and ease of management are paramount, such as in telecommunications networks, large enterprise backbones, or service provider infrastructures. The ability to remotely manage and troubleshoot media conversion points reduces operational costs and improves network responsiveness. The specific media types and speeds supported would depend on the individual modules installed within the CFBRM1329-102 system.
